Navajo Pine was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their ninth straight loss dating back to last season. They came up short against the McCurdy Bobcats, falling 18-12. On the bright side, the 12- run performance marked the Warriors' highest-scoring game to date.
Navajo Pine's defeat dropped their record down to 0-7. As for McCurdy, with the victory, they broke their six-game losing streak and moved their record to 2-8.
Navajo Pine has already played their next contest, a 19-8 loss against Hot Springs on the 5th. As for McCurdy,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next match, a 20-1 defeat against Estancia on the 5th.
